Program Helps Farmers Fight World Hunger

The Ohio Soybean Council is encouraging Ohio farmers to join a relatively World Soy Foundation program to donate the equivalent market value of one acre of soybeans in the battle against malnutrition. 

One acre of soybeans, when converted into soybean oil and flour, can provide enough protein to meet the full caloric needs for 80 people for a full month. Similarly, one acre of soybeans, an excellent source of protein that is low in transfats, can be used to make more than 40,000 eight-ounce servings of soymilk.

More than 950 million people worldwide are undernourished, and untold millions of children suffer from growth and learning deficiencies resulting from inadequate nutrition.
